How much do cable design eng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for cable design engineer in the United States is $43.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34.62 and $50.00 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ges a Cable Design Engineer might face on the job?

Cable Design Engineers often encounter challenges such as accommodating complex project specifications while meeting industry standards and safety regulations. Managing evolving client requirements or site constraints may require creative solutions and close attention to detail. Additionally, engineers frequently need to collaborate with cross-functional teams, including manufacturing, installation, and quality assurance, to ensure seamless implementation of designs. Staying current with technology trends and regulatory changes is also important for long-term career success.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Cable Design Engineer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Cable Design Engineer, you need a strong background in electrical or mechanical engineering, proficiency in cable design principles, and typically a relevant bachelor's degree. Familiarity with CAD software (such as AutoCAD or SolidWorks), industry codes (like NEC or IEC standards), and sometimes certifications like Certified Cable Engineer are often required. Attention to detail, effective communication, and problem-solving abilities are important soft skills in this field. These competencies ensure that cable systems are designed safely, efficiently, and collaboratively within multidisciplinary engineering teams.

What does a Cable Design Engineer do?

A Cable Design Engineer is responsible for designing, developing, and testing electrical or fiber optic cables used in various industries, such as telecommunications, power distribution, and automotive. They create detailed cable specifications, select appropriate materials, and ensure compliance with industry standards. Their role often involves working with cross-functional teams to optimize performance, reliability, and cost-effectiveness.

The Harness and Cable Design group is an organization that is responsible for mechanical and electrical design tasks relating to wire harness, cable design, and interconnecting of electronic equipment. Our organization primarily supports satellite spacecraft design, however there is opportunity to support many of LM Space's missions.

Key activities you will accomplish in this role:
In this role, you will work closely alongside experienced engineers to help meet safety, schedule, and cost.
Your scope of responsibility will include supporting the technical development and coordination of harness and cable assembly manufacturing drawings, harness parts lists, wire connection lists, engineering change support, and/or schematic capture of wiring diagrams.
Additionally, your contributions will aid in investigating design factors such as part availability, manufacturability, ease of assembly, weight, and cost.
Additional responsibilities may include: documentation release, testing requirement definition, Interface Control Drawing (ICD) interpretation, detailed Component Performance Specification interpretation, conceptual designs, and trade studies.
